Francesca Jones vs Lina Glushko
Head-to-head: First meeting
Francesca Jones has been on fire in the last few months, winning the WTA 125 in Contrexeville, WTA 250 in Palermo, and qualifying for the US Open. It’s led her to a Top 100 debut and in a draw like Sao Paulo, she should be a factor. Last week in Guadalajara, she also produced a solid run with a quarterfinal exit to Panna Udvardy. It just seems like right now she’s at a level where you can expect wins against lower-ranked opponents from her consistently, especially with Lina Glushko struggling to get anything going this year. Prediction: Jones in 2
Valeriya Strakhova vs Ana Candiotto
Head-to-head: Strakhova 3-0
Ana Candiotto is getting a major opportunity here, debuting on the WTA Tour despite never being ranked inside the Top 500. She also played doubles with Beatriz Haddad Maia, who must be a major inspiration for any Brazilian up-and-comer. A cinderella run from someone like her could really put this event in Sao Paulo on the tennis map this week. But it’s going to be difficult to get it and while Valeriya Strakhova never broke through, she’s been around the ITF circuit forever. Prediction: Strakhova in 2
